Sage-Marinated Pork Chops Stuffed with Walnut-Cranberry Cornbread Dressing recipe

Serves 6.

The chops should be at least an inch thick to accommodate the stuffing.

Sage Marinade:
3 tablespoons olive oil
2 cloves garlic, minced
2 tablespoons dried sage

Pork chops:
6 thick pork chops (about 1 inch thick)
1 recipe Walnut-Cranberry Corn Bread Stuffing (see recipe)
4 tablespoon olive oil, divided

Heat oven to 425 degrees F.

Prepare marinade by combining olive oil, garlic and sage in a small bowl. Rub marinade into pork chops. Slash a horizontal pocket in pork chops, cutting through to bone. Place about 3/4 cup stuffing in each pork chop cavity.

In a large skillet over medium heat, add 3 tablespoons oil; cook 2 or 3 chops at a time until browned on one side (about 5 minutes). Turn and brown second side (about 3 minutes). Remove and reserve. Add remaining oil and repeat with remaining chops.

Place pork chops in a small roasting pan and bake until center of meat registers 160 degrees (medium) or 170 degrees F (well done) and center of stuffing registers 165 degrees F (about 25 minutes). Serve immediately.

Nutrition information per serving: Calories 560; Carbohydrates 19 g; Protein 28 g; Fat 42 g including sat. fat 12 g; Cholesterol 112 mg; Sodium 760 mg; Calcium 99 mg; Dietary fiber 2 g

Diabetic exchanges per serving: 1 vegetable exchange, 1 bread/ starch exchange, 6 lean-meat exchanges and 5 fat exchanges
